Alvin Frank Flanagan, Jr., age 83, peacefully passed away at his home surrounded by his loving family on Wednesday, January 7, 2026. He enjoyed being outdoors, turkey hunting, and fly fishing. Alvin was known to fix anything and everything that needed fixing, naming him "Mr. Fix-it". He proudly served his country in the US Air Force for 4 years. Alvin retired as an Operator from Dupont after many dedicated years. After retiring, he and his wife, Mrs. Shirley, volunteered at Habitat for Humanity and the Fuller Shop for 20 years, helping the less fortunate get back on their feet. In his family, he was known as the family cook; his famous gumbo, red beans and rice, and spaghetti will be deeply missed on their Sunday family tradition. He was a wholehearted Christian man, who served as a deacon at Woodland Park Baptist Church and later went to Bethlehem Baptist Church where he taught bible study. Alvin was a people person who could talk to anyone and make them feel welcome, who would witness to them and share the word of his Lord and Savior Jesus Christ. In his spare time, he could often be found babysitting his grandchildren, which he truly enjoyed. Alvin was affectionately called, "PawPaw" by his family, who could tell the best stories, give the tightest hugs and always had the right words to say. Paw Paw was a wonderful husband, father, grandfather, great-grandfather, and friend to all who knew him and is already looking down from heaven with a smile on his face.
